A deluxe double disc version of the New World, which clocks at more than 140-minutes, is available to order on the website and it is stacked with special guest contributors and collaborators including Steve Hackett of Genesis, Durga McBroom from Pink Floyd, Francis Dunnery of It Bites, Nick D'Virgilio of Tears for Fears and Big Big Train, Colin Edwin of Porcupine Tree and other iconic artists. Kerzner, who is a co-founder of award-winning progressive rock band Sound of Contact, describes the record as bringing together classic rock elements of the 60s and 70s into a modern musical soundscape. more on this story TeamRock Radio is an official news provider for antiMusic.com.
